News: God Dethroned Reveal Final Single ‘The Hanged Man’; New Album ‘The Judas Paradox’ And EU/UK Tour Kicking

God Dethroned, one of the most respected Dutch extreme metal acts, will unleash their new studio album next Friday, on September 6, 2024, via Reigning Phoenix Music (RPM).

The band has just released the final single ‘The Hanged Man.’ Leading down the final steps towards the sonic abyss that is “The Judas Paradox,” the track immediately suffocates listeners with crushing double-bass drumming and bass – without losing its melodic sense in the form of scheming lead guitars though! Judas Iscariot, the main inspiration behind the album title, once again lurks around in the lyrics, rounding off yet another striking song out of the band’s hellish forge.

Frontman Henri “The Serpent King” Sattler comments:

“A song which lyrics are based on the ‘The Hanged Man’ tarot card. Lyrically very simple yet extremely catchy. The reason I decided to use tarot cards as a basis to write lyrics is because I like them and their meanings and it gave me the opportunity to write a different type of lyrics that I hadn’t used before. The tarot card of ‘The Hanged Man’ is about sacrifice. Musically it’s a groovy death metal banger with a middle part that shows Dave Meester’s skills as a virtuoso on lead guitar. Especially in this song you get the feeling that the death metal version of Dave Murray is present in his utmost glory,”
